Having downloaded an internet copy of Sri Jiva Gosvami's Krishna-sandarbha, I've skimmed across the first anuccheda or so without having time to read it carefully. As far as I can see, Sri Jiva begins by explaining the supremacy of 'Bhagavan'. I assume that later on he will argue that Krishna is identical with Bhagavan, and that this is the foundation for the GV doctrine of Krishna's supremacy. Posted by "Gaurasundara das" @ 02:36.
